AI Contract Overview
This contract, awarded to BELL BOEING JOINT PROJECT OFFICE (CAGE 3B1R2) under the Defense Logistics Agency, is a delivery order valued at $4,444.40 issued under the Basic Ordering Agreement SPE4A124G0009. The sole line item specifies the procurement of 10 units of a structural plate, AI, identified by NSN 1560016842891 and part number SRPV2200371-115, with an allowable quantity range of 9 to 10 units. The contract is governed by a fixed-price structure and falls under the NAICS code 332312. The place of performance, packaging, and inspection is designated as The Boeing Company in Ridley Park, Pennsylvania, with FOB origin terms meaning the government assumes responsibility for transportation upon delivery to that site. Delivery must be completed by October 29, 2027, and all shipments must include gross weight and cubic feet measurements, with packages clearly marked using block letters and the identification numbers from the contract documentation. The contract incorporates a comprehensive set of federal acquisition regulations, including mandatory cybersecurity compliance with DFARS 252.204-7012 and 252.204-7009, requiring safeguarding of covered defense information, cyber incident reporting, and adherence to NIST SP 800-171 standards. The contractor must submit cybersecurity self-assessments via the Supplier Performance Risk System and flow these requirements down to subcontractors. Payment must be submitted through Wide Area WorkFlow with no other invoicing systems permitted, and accelerated payments to small business subcontractors are mandated under FAR 52.232-40. The contracting officer’s representative is Gordon Lucas of DLA Aviation, and payments are routed through the Defense Finance and Accounting Service in Columbus, Ohio. The award reflects small business status, with no other socioeconomic designations confirmed. The contract includes clauses on defense priority requirements, prohibition of fluorinated fire-fighting agents, limitations on litigation-support information disclosure, and the Federal Acquisition Supply Chain Security Act with Alternates I and II enforced. No packaging specifications, preservation methods, or bar-coding requirements are detailed, and no formal evaluation factors or award methodology are disclosed in the available data.
